Main information about car part ALFA ROMEO/FIAT/LANCIA 405909
Producer ALFA ROMEO/FIAT/LANCIA
Number 405909
Description Tie Rod End
Analogue of ALFA ROMEO/FIAT/LANCIA 405909
KRAFT AUTOMOTIVE KRAFT AUTOMOTIVE 4315590 4315590 Tie Rod End
MOOG MOOG PE-ES-5042 PEES5042 Tie Rod End
PROFIT PROFIT 2302-0301 23020301 Tie Rod End
RTS RTS 91-00570 9100570 Tie Rod End
TALOSA TALOSA 42-08326 4208326 Tie Rod End
The other parts with the same number "405909"
ALFA ROMEO 405909 Tie Rod End
OEM 405909 Tie Rod End
GENERAL MOTORS 405909
A.B.S. 405909 Tie Rod End
PETERS ENNEPETAL 405909 TIE ROD END
WAT 405909 Tie Rod End
CITROEN/PEUGEOT 4059.09 Tie Rod End
PEUGEOT 405909 Tie Rod End
PEUGEOT (DF-PSA) 405909 Tie Rod End
LANCIA 405909 Tie Rod End
FIAT 405909 Tie Rod End
CITROEN 405909 Tie Rod End
KLAXCAR FRANCE 405909 Tie Rod End
OE 405909 STEERING tip SCUDO/EXPERT